I wouldn't rule out the possibility that this is the end of Ash. The show is doing a lot the things that you would expect it to do if it were getting ready to wrap things up with Ash winning a league, then aiming for the #1 rank, and older characters returning.

In terms of the future of animated Pokemon content, I think it's possible they do what a lot of other franchises are doing these days (Marvel, DC, Transformers and even Power Rangers) by creating different content for different age groups. You could have some preschool show like "Pikachu and Friends" and another show with a somewhat older bent, perhaps one that more directly adapts the games. They've sort of already moved in this direction with Twilight Wings and Generations but those were just shorts.
Granted, this franchise has never really cared about older fans which is why I was kind of reluctant to even suggest this.
